| Whole Foods, Herbs, Spices & Seasonal Cooking Workshop
6th March 2010 10am-4pm
You know the saying “you are what you eat”? Well, food can help build your body and has an effect on physical and mental well-being. In that case we should pay attention to what we are putting into our bodies.
Research indicates that eating quality whole foods (as opposed to mass produced processed fast food) is beneficial to health and vitality. So, what to choose and how to cook them in a tasty, nutritious and tempting way. This workshop explains what to use, preparation methods and their nutrient properties helping to support health and creating a balanced diet.
Herbs and spices will also be used to help you learn how they can enhance flavour and support good health
This course will support you in preparing and cooking whole foods using mainly seasonal ingredients in order to make delicious, tasty, attractive looking and nutritious meals for yourself, family and friends.
By the end of the course you will:
- Be able to cook whole grains (brown rice, quinoa, barley, millet, couscous etc.); pulses (beans, lentils, chick peas etc.); sea vegetables (kombu, nori etc.); nuts, seeds, condiments, miso, tofu and tempeh
- Observe demonstrations and prepare under the cook’s guidance several delicious whole food dishes, which will form part of a balanced diet, using seasonal foods, herbs and spices
- Be able to prepare and enjoy eating what you cook and receive advice and coaching about whatever you want to know about preparing and cooking great food!
